Russell "Bubba" Archer Houston, Jr., 60, of Toano, passed away on March 24, 2014. Born in Hopewell, VA he was the son of the late Russell A. Sr. and Betty Frith Houston; and was also preceded in death by two brothers, Michael A. and Jeffrey A. Houston; one sister, Terri Lynn Houston; and a niece, Michele Griffin. Russell worked over 35 years and retired from the Virginia Dominion Power Plant in Yorktown, VA. He had a love for fast cars, boating, and loved and enjoyed fellowship and fun times with family and many friends. Russell spent time witnessing to others about his Lord and Savior, and encouraged many to give their life to the Lord as he had done many years ago. He is survived by his loving sisters, Katie H. Fenderson and husband, David, Janet H. Griffin, and Sheila H. Fields and husband, Bobby; two nephews, Michael Fields and Austen Spainhour; four nieces, Chelsy Bowe, Donna Fields-DuVall, Jessica Griffin and Kaylee Fenderson; three great-nephews, Joshua Griffin, Samuel and William Bowe; special aunt, Shirley Lovering; special uncle, Aubrey Houston; his special friend, Regina Dance and many other very close and dear friends. The family will receive friends from 6:00 to 9:00 p.m. on Wednesday, March 26, 2014 at the Chester Chapel of J.T. Morriss and Son Funeral Home. A funeral service will be conducted at 1:00 p.m. on Thursday at the funeral home. Interment will follow in Sunset Memorial Park, Chester, VA.
